Planning Your Visit

Embrace the Seine Views

Quai Henri IV offers stunning views of the Seine River and iconic Parisian landmarks. Plan for leisurely strolls, especially during sunrise or sunset, to capture the magic. Consider the weather; a light jacket is often recommended even in warmer months due to the river breeze.

Dining Delights & Local Finds

This quay is home to diverse culinary experiences, from authentic Thai to seafood specialties. Research restaurants in advance, as some popular spots can get busy. Keep an eye out for local markets and pop-up events for unique gastronomic discoveries.

🚇 🗺️ Getting There

Quai Henri IV is easily accessible by Paris Métro. The closest stations are Sully-Morland (Line 7) and Saint-Paul (Line 1). You can also reach it by bus or by a scenic walk along the Seine. :bus: :train:

Yes, Quai Henri IV is centrally located and walkable from many popular sites like Notre Dame Cathedral, Île Saint-Louis, and the Marais district. :walking:

The Métro lines 7 (Sully-Morland) and 1 (Saint-Paul) are your best bet. Several bus lines also serve the area, offering convenient access. :metro:

Driving is possible, but parking in central Paris can be challenging and expensive. It's generally recommended to use public transport or ride-sharing services. :car:

The quay itself is largely flat and accessible. Public transport stations may have varying levels of accessibility, so check in advance if needed. :wheelchair:
